Bhumibol Dam

Characteristics of Dam & Power Plant


Characteristics of Dam

TypeConcrete
Height154 m
Crest length486 m
Crest width6 m
Reservoir area13,462 million m3
Special characteristicsBhumibol Dam is the only concrete arch dam in Thailand.
It is the largest and highest arch dam in Southeast Asia ranking the 8th of the world.

Characteristics of Power Plant

StructureReinforced concrete
Number of generators8
Generating capacity of Units 1-682.20 MW (per unit)
Generating capacity of Units 7115 MW
Generating capacity of Units 8 (pumped storage)171 MW
Contracted generating capacity779.20 MW
Annual generated electricity1,062 million kWh

Lower Mae Ping Dam

Characteristics of Dam

TypeClay core covered with rockfill
Height12 m
Crest length200 m
Crest width10 m
Dam crest elevation142.00 m MSL
Reservoir area4.92 million m3
Special characteristicsLower Mae Ping Dam stores water released from Bhumibol Dam
for pumping back to the reversible pump of Unit 8
and discharge water as required.

Spillway

StructureReinforced concrete
Height14 m
Length144 m
Width28 m
Channel of drainage10
Width of each channel10.5 m
